Sunbird Lilongwe women interactive dinner

Listen to this article

Women from all walks of life shared business tips at an interactive dinner and dance organised by Sunbird Lilongwe Hotel.

It was the first of its kind of a ladies night as it was solely organised to give women an opportunity to get together, network and share business ideas.

It was a clear mixture of business and pleasure as apart from letting loose and have a good time while being treated to the best food that Sunbird Lilongwe Hotel offered with beautiful music on the background, a number of women running different businesses shared tips on how they have managed to remain strong on the competitive market.

“I started my business in the late 80s as a vegetable seller. I used to move from NRC with a basked of vegetables to town and would at times spend a day without making not event a penny. But I remained strong, I persevered and worked hard. Right now, I own a clothing shop in Lilongwe,” said Helalo’s Fashion house owner, Eve Chikhadzula.

Other than that, the women also made pledges through Habitat for Humanity Malawi Women’s Build Initiative, which is soliciting funds to build houses for widows. For the night, the women made pledges for the construction of a K1.6 million house for Dorifa Chitekwere, and old woman looking after her three orphaned grandchildren in Salima.

A live music performance by Daughters Band from Music Crossroads Academy entertained the women all night long plus DJ Ann on the decks.

Different prizes including one month free gym, dinner, lunch and Sunbird Hotel branded pens and notebooks were also given out to lucky women.
